So far all units of other countries are only non-core, because they only appear in one scenario.
Romanians are an exception, there are two Romanian scenarios - Kishinev and Odessa. Some Romanian units gain experience in the first scenario so they could receive some attachments.
After adding Odessa scenario to 1941 campaign Romanians can also be core units and gain experience.
This very small Romanian campaign, named ''Luptatori'' (Warriors in Romanian) will include Kishinev and Odessa scenarios. Some infantry divisions, 7th cavalry brigade, some artillery units and air force will be core.
German units will be auxiliary in this campaign.
Before Odessa scenario the core units from Army Group Antonescu will be transferred to the 4th Romanian army and used in Odessa scenario.
This is a small test campaign to see how Army Group Antonescu works, so that 1941 campaign can have some Romanians with experience.
Odessa scenario is very challenging and a good tutorial before attacking fortified lines - Epic Wjasma, Mozhaisk and Moscow.
